6.6.7 Invalid parameters when adaptive effective
When the adaptive function is effective (P2-01.0=1), the invalid parameters are shown as below:
First speed loop integral time constant
Second speed loop integral time constant
Second position loop gain
/I-SEL inertia ratio switch
